Bose Music App Update – April 27th 2021

May 7th update 

A new version of the app, 4.4.5, is being rolled out to Android users over the next couple days. This update is to fix an issue were the app could unexpectedly close. There is no further update to the previous release notes.

 

Original Post

Use this thread to discuss the Bose Music Update that was made on April 27th. As a reminder, the release details are below:

 

Version Information:

  • iOS: 4.4.3
  • Android:  4.4.4

 

Release Notes

  • Get going faster – Now when you set up your Bose headphones and earbuds, you can skip creating an account and get right to enjoying your product. Create an account later in the Settings menu.
  • We made the app experience for soundbars and speakers even better, with faster and easier access to your product controls, favorites, and music services.
  • EQ control has a new look for your NC 700 Headphones. Enjoy a new graphical interface plus EQ presets.
  • A few tweaks and fine-tuning to make the app more stable and less buggy.

 

Android Only (already available on iOS):

  • Deepen your connection to the world around you with Spotify for our Bose Noise Cancelling 700 Headphones. Easily get the audio you want—and need—in an instant with a tap and hold on the right earcup. The Spotify Shortcut for Headphones 700 will be made available for Android users.

 

Compatible OS versions  

We have removed support for Android 6: See additional details here.

 

  • Android: 7.0 and up 
  • iOS: 12 and up 

Hi!

 

So before the update on the 27th of April of the Bose Music app I was able to group speakers in the following sequence that is soundbar with bose home speaker 300 and bose smart portable speaker  and afterwards with simple link I connected revolve speaker. After the update I can only group or all the smart speakers or 1 smart speaker and 1 revolve speaker. Do you expect to fix this?

 

From the pictures you can clearly see that with

 new version it is unsupported.

 

Android version bose music app 4.4.4.

 

On the print screen I did not add revolve to the group sync then it is not visible what is in the group you can only end the whole group. But before the update it definitely worked.

 

The first picture is the new app and the second is the old app version. From the second you can see that it was possible to add bose revolve soundlink additionally to the Bose portable and bathroom speaker (both smart)
